The importance of hydrogen has grown as a result of the energy revolution. The proportion of vehicles powered by hydrogen is steadily increasing. Since hydrogen is highly flammable, operators of hydrogen filling stations are obliged to protect people and equipment.
The right path to lightning and surge protection for hydrogen filling stations
Fuel stations are public areas where it is important to protect the people who use them and work there from any danger and also to prevent the systems from breaking down. Even more specific framework conditions apply to hydrogen filling stations. If hydrogen ignites in an uncontrolled manner or forms an explosive mixture with other components, people and equipment can be harmed.
To prevent this, we develop comprehensive protection concepts with protective devices especially for potentially explosive areas, which include external lightning protection and surge protection as well as earthing and equipotential bonding. Our protective devices help prevent sparking – a reaction that can lead to explosions in potentially explosive areas. Lightning protection systems ensure that no partial lightning currents flow into the system and that no interactions with potentially explosive areas can occur.
Our lightning protection systems and air-termination systems are installed at a distance from installations by means of an insulator. We use high-quality glass-fibre reinforced plastic as the insulation material. The design and dimensioning of the holding and functional units are based on electrical and mechanical parameters.
